Pasadena boys soccer team remains in top spot

Pasadena High School remains atop the Pacific League standings and the west San Gabriel Valley poll despite a loss to Hoover last week. The Bulldogs can take big advantage in the league race with a win vs. Burroughs on Friday.

1. Pasadena (10-1-2)
Rebounded from loss to Hoover with 1-0 win over Muir (1)
2. Monrovia (13-4-5)
Wildcats haven’t lost in more than month (3)
3. La Canada (6-4-5)
Played Monrovia to 1-1 tie (4)
4. Pasadena Poly (9-4-1)
Rematch vs. Firebaugh on Wednesday (2)
5. Flintridge Prep (7-2-2)
Lost first Prep League game to Firebaugh (5)
6. Maranatha (8-6-2)
Played Flintridge Prep to 1-1 tie (6)
7. Muir (8-5-2)
Third place in Pacific League (8)
8. St. Francis (4-7-4)
In third place in tough Mission League
9. Marshall (9-6-2)
In third-place tie in Mission Valley (10)
10. Temple City (7-7)
Third-place showdown vs. San Marino Wednesday (unranked)

Girls soccer
Westridge 7, Firebaugh 1 — Kaitlin Zareno scored three goals and Charlotte Stephens and Olivia Matthiessen both scored a goal to lead the Tigers (4-6) to the Prep League victory. Makala Thomas had two assists for Westridge.

Girls basketball

Sophia Song had 11 points, 10 rebounds and eight steals and Vanessa Aguirre tallied 11 points, eight assists and six steals to lead Keppel (11-7, 2-0) to a 73-21 victory over San Gabriel in an Almont League girls basketball game Friday.
Also contributing to the Aztecs’ win was Jocelyn Song who had 10 points.

La Canada 65, San Marino 24 — Amber Graves had 18 points and five rebounds, Alexi Nazarian had 16 points and three assists and Zoe Williams registered 12 points and five rebounds for the Spartans (15-2, 2-0) in a Rio Hondo League contest.
Schurr 71, Montebello 30 — Alicia Aguirre had 19 points and Kirstyn Middo had 16 points to lead the Spartans (9-9, 2-0) to the Almont League victory. The Spartans outscored Montebello (9-8, 0-2) 58-23 over the final three quarters. Alisia Trejo had 10 points for the Oilers.

Boys basketball
Village Christian 67, Maranatha 64 — Terrance Lang had 25 points and eight rebounds and Trevor Stanback had 15 points and six rebounds for the Minutemen (6-9, 0-1) in an Olympic League loss.
